DRESSER INDUSTRIES, INC. v. BALDRIDGE

Civ. A. No. 82-2385.

549 F.Supp. 108 (1982)

DRESSER INDUSTRIES, INC. and Dresser (France) S.A., Plaintiffs, v. Malcolm BALDRIDGE, Secretary United States Department of Commerce, et al., Defendants.

United States District Court, District of Columbia.

September 13, 1982.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John Vanderstar, Covington & Burling, Washington, D.C., for plaintiffs.

Richard K. Willard, U.S. Dept. of Justice, Washington, D.C., for defendants.


ORDER

JOYCE HENS GREEN, District Judge.

This action was filed on August 23, 1982, by plaintiffs, Dresser Industries, Incorporated, and Dresser (France), S.A., seeking injunctive relief preventing defendants, the Secretary of Commerce and other officials of the Department of Commerce, from imposing sanctions on Dresser (France) for violating regulations prohibiting the export of certain goods to the Soviet Union.
